    Abstract: A hybrid power system has two voltage sources, a variable DC power source, and a second power source, connected through selection components to a common node. The variable DC power source may be a solar power source and the second source may be an AC grid. The selection components, e.g. blocking diodes, SCRs, or relays, allow one or both of the sources to be connected to the node depending on the voltages produced by the sources. A variable speed drive and load may be connected to the node.

    Abstract: In a readily switchable multiple solar panel system, the individual solar panels are interconnected with a control or switching apparatus which allows the solar panels to be readily switched into various series, parallel, or series-parallel configurations. With a relay based switching apparatus, a relay is connected between a pair of solar panels, so that in a first state, the panels are in series where the total voltage is the sum of each individual panel's voltage. When the relay is switched to the second state, each solar panel is in parallel, where the total voltage is a single panel's voltage and the current is multiplied by the number of panels. Multiple panels can be connected in this manner, with a relay between each successive pair of panels. With each relay connected in a parallel arrangement, a simple control switch in series with the relay coils can control the panel switching. The coil of each relay can also be individually controlled.

    Abstract: It is difficult to control a variable speed converter or inverter so that an AC motor or other load may be operated from a DC source under varying source and/or load conditions. A DC bias voltage control related to AC frequency by a predetermined relationship is used to control the DC to AC converter. For variable speed AC converters, a low voltage bias control circuit is effectively used to control motor frequency by applying a bias voltage to the converter so that the load requirements are optimally met by the available DC source voltage. The controller can be used in many DC source—bias controlled converter—AC load systems formed with the bias controlled drive, for example a solar powered water pump in which a DC photovoltaic panel is used to power an AC pump motor.
